About this Program:

The Engineering Development Group (EDG) at MathWorks is a proven, excellent technical and leadership development program designed to cultivate the next generation of leaders and innovators within our Software Development organization. As a member of EDG, you’ll have the flexibility to select your own projects, be mentored by industry experts in areas such as software engineering, quality engineering, user experience, technical writing, and more.

The program is designed to provide opportunities to support your learning and growth to transition to roles in Development to continue the next step of your career at MathWorks. We offer technical learning opportunities in areas such as full-stack software development (with languages including C++, MATLAB, JavaScript and Go),high-performance computing, cloud computing integration, AI, deep learning & text analytics, physical modelling, embedded systems, text analytics, code generation & verification and wireless communications.

Mission

As part of our Development organization, you will join a diverse and collaborative team, contributing to impactful software engineering projects and providing technical support to customers. This unique blend of work is designed to foster continuous learning and professional growth. Specifically, you will:

  • Benefit from extensive learning opportunities through training, mentorship and knowledge sharing forums to specialize & develop deeper technical skills.
  • Learn about MathWorks products and user workflows through helping customers troubleshoot and resolve their technical challenges to build a user-centric perspective.
  • Contribute to impactful technical projects with teams across our Development organisation.
  • Grow your leadership skills by demonstrating initiative, leading process improvement projects, coaching and mentoring others.
  • Explore different teams to discover your passion and transition to a role in Development that is perfect for you.

Qualifications

  • Masters/Ph.D. in Engineering, Computer Science, or another STEM subject
  • Consistent, well-rounded academic track record, including excellent communication and time management skills
  • Proficiency in at least one programming language.
  • Solid understanding of object-oriented programming principles (for CS degree candidates)
  • Experience with MATLAB/Simulink is a plus, but not required

MathWorks conçoit MATLAB et Simulink, les principaux logiciels de calcul scientifique utilisés par les ingénieurs et les scientifiques. La société emploie plus de 6 500 personnes dans 16 pays avec un siège social situé à Natick, dans le Massachusetts (États-Unis). MathWorks est une société privée qui a dégagé des bénéfices chaque année depuis sa création en 1984.
